20th century ghost short stories often reflect the cultural fears and anxieties of the time. For example, many stories were influenced by the two World Wars, with ghosts representing the trauma and loss. Writers like M.R. James created stories where the ghosts were often vengeful, which could be seen as a way to explore the darker aspects of human nature.
The settings in 20th century ghost short stories are quite diverse. They could be set in old, decaying mansions which added to the spooky atmosphere. These settings were not just for the sake of horror but also to comment on the passing of old ways of life. Some stories also had modern settings, showing that the idea of the supernatural could penetrate even the most 'rational' of modern spaces.
